I guess what your mate is going to do is hand scrape the block ?? or worse !!! what ever he is planning on doing will result in total eventual wastage of your hard earned cash.......
Grinding material WILL get in to your engine it WILL destroy it, no matter how careful he is some element of swarf or cutting compound etc WILL enter the WRONG places
ferrous metals around your piston rings will glow red and pre-ignite and could lead to severe piston damage
DO NOT LET HIM TOUCH YOUR ENGINE
To strip your engine down for skimming will cost you time, a set of gaskets, descent head gasket (BK450), oil, filter, thread lock and any bits that are damaged.
Ok if this is a new engine why is the block not flat ?
how are you checking that the block is flat ?
What tools are you using to "diagnose" a warped block ?
warped "A" series blocks are not that common !
If it is warped then it will have to be done on a machine, either a mill, or for preference a vertical spindle surface grinder
